Beauty brands face unique image cropping challenges that generic platforms can't address. Skincare products need crops that emphasize texture and ingredient visibility. Makeup items require color accuracy and application context. Fragrance bottles benefit from lifestyle crops that suggest the scent experience. Common mistakes include cropping too tightly (losing product context), too loosely (reducing visual impact), or failing to maintain consistent aspect ratios across product categories. What's the ideal image format and file size for order confirmation emails?
Use JPEG for photographic product images and PNG for graphics or logos with transparency. Target file size of 25-50KB per image and dimensions of 300x300 to 600x600 pixels depending on your email template width. Mobile email viewing averages only 10 seconds, so oversized or slow-loading images cause immediate abandonment. Should I A/B test different crop images for order confirmations?
Yes—A/B testing crop images is one of the highest-impact optimizations for beauty brands. Test variations like product-only versus lifestyle shots, close-ups versus full-product views, and different angles or color representations. Run tests across at least 500 subscribers per variation to reach statistical significance.
